Description

The Arbitration Agreement is a pivotal document related to the purchase of a manufactured home, outlining the process for resolving disputes through arbitration instead of court trials. Arbitration, in simple terms, allows parties to settle disagreements outside the courtroom, often in a more streamlined and private manner. This Agreement ensures that all claims linked to the purchase, including financing and installation issues, are addressed through arbitration administered by the American Arbitration Association, guided by their established rules. Key features include a requirement for written notice to initiate arbitration and guidelines for selecting arbitrators based on claim amounts. For amounts under Twenty Thousand Dollars ($20,000.00), a single arbitrator is used; for larger claims, a panel of three is employed.
